Output 7ddd14777fe34c8ef594a8661ec8b4e20fb8f9edf792958dde8402da1482e449:0

value
5663553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4d20873f775a44b2fc8b7685c03aa9de1ebcd5 OP_EQUAL
address
3Jwx2gWdRqmuCHjzLErCD4ChMJm2BKhWYh
transaction
7ddd14777fe34c8ef594a8661ec8b4e20fb8f9edf792958dde8402da1482e449
spent
true